Common Building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ens uneven or sinking foundations.
Pier and beam repair - addresses issues with raised or damaged piers and support beams.
Cracked foundation repair - seals and reinforces cracks to prevent further damage and water intrusion.
Basement foundation repair - restores stability to basement walls affected by shifting or settling.
Concrete slab stabilization - corrects uneven or cracked concrete slabs to improve safety and appearance.
Foundation waterproofing - prevents water from seeping through foundation walls and causing damage.
Building Foundation Repair Questions
What signs indicate a foundation needs repair? C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ick may signal foundation issues.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Soil movement, poor drainage, and settling over time can lead to foundation settling or shifting.
What types of foundation repair are available?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and sealing cracks to stabilize and restore the foundation.
How can property owners prevent fo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ent serious problems.
